الملخص

مكتمل

تتكون هذه الوحدة من دمج البيانات والخدمات في وظائفك. بدأنا بجولة سريعة بأنواع الربط التي تظهر عند إضافتها إلى دالة. ثم بحثنا في قراءة البيانات من Azure Cosmos DB باستخدام ربط إدخال. تهتم Azure Functions بإدارة سلسلة الاتصال، ورأينا كيف يمكن قراءة البيانات في التعليمات البرمجية الخاصة بنا بسهولة باستخدام الربط. وأخيرًا، ركزنا اهتمامنا على كتابة البيانات في مصادر مختلفة بمساعدة روابط الإخراج.

يتم تلخيص هذه الرحلة في الجدول التالي، الذي يعرض الروابط المختلفة التي استخدمتها في كل وحدة من الوحدات المذكورة.

وحدة التعلم أزرار التشغيل روابط الإدخال روابط الإخراج
استكشاف أنواع ربط الإدخال والإخراج HTTP HTTP HTTP
قراءة البيانات باستخدام روابط الإدخال HTTP HTTP
Azure Cosmos DB
HTTP
كتابة البيانات باستخدام روابط الإخراج HTTP HTTP
Azure Cosmos DB
HTTP
Azure Cosmos DB
تخزين قائمة انتظار Azure

يمكنك تطبيق الأساليب التي تعلمتها هنا لإضافة الروابط واختبارها في وظائفك. فيما يلي بعض الأفكار المثيرة للاهتمام للحصول على المزيد من الممارسات مع الروابط والبناء على ما تعلمته.

  • إنشاء دالة أخرى للقراءة من تخزين Blob واستخدام روابط الإدخال الأخرى التي لم نستخدمها في هذه الوحدة النمطية.

  • إنشاء دالة أخرى للكتابة إلى المزيد من الوجهات باستخدام أنواع رابط الإخراج المعتمدة الأخرى.

  • في الوحدة السابقة، قدمنا قائمة انتظار ونشر الرسائل إليها مع رابط الإخراج. كخطوة تالية، ضع في اعتبارك إضافة دالة أخرى تقرأ الرسائل في قائمة الانتظار وتطبع MESSAGE TEXT إلى وحدة التحكم باستخدام console.log().

كما رأينا في هذه الوحدة، يوفر مدخل Azure ميزات سهلة الاستخدام لبدء إنشاء وظائف وربطها بالبيانات والخدمات الأخرى.

إذا كنت مهتما بإجراء عمليات تكامل بلا خادم مثل هذه مع مهام سير العمل المرئية والقليل من التعليمات البرمجية المخصصة أو بدونها، فراجع Azure Logic Apps أيضا.

تنظيف

تُنظف بيئة الاختبار المعزولة مواردك تلقائيًا ما إن تنتهي من هذه الوحدة النمطية.

عندما تعمل على اشتراكك الخاص، من الأفضل أن تُحدد في نهاية المشروع ما إذا كنت لا تزال بحاجة إلى الموارد التي أنشأتها أو لا. يمكن أن تكلفك الموارد التي لا تزال قيد التشغيل الأموال. يمكنك حذف الموارد بشكل فردي أو حذف مجموعة الموارد لحذف تشكيلة الموارد بأكملها.

معرفة المزيد

ترتبط الموارد التالية بالمواضيع التي تغطيها هذه الوحدة النمطية التي قد تجدها مثيرة للاهتمام:

‏‫اختبر معلوماتك

1.

أي من العبارات التالية تصف ميزة استخدام الروابط في Azure Functions للوصول إلى مصادر البيانات ومتلقين البيانات؟

2.

ما هو اسم الملف الذي يحتوي على بيانات تكوين الوظيفة؟

3.

كم عدد المشغلات التي يجب أن تكون لها وظيفة؟